Susan appears to be inspired by Susan Smith - Both are abductors and attempted murders of children in their family (though only Smith succeeded), had unhappy marriages, were motivated by trying to stay in a relationship (with Jacobs' husband and Smith's new boyfriend accordingly), used ruses to lure their children away and get them alone, filed false police reports to divert suspicion (Jacobs copied the murder of another girl at the mall, Smith alleged a fictitious black man killed her kids), portrayed the act of a mother in distress as part of their ruses, and share the same first name. In 2007, a girl the same age as Katie was abducted from the mall and later found dead, news which prompted Susan into enacting a desperate plan which she believed could save her marriage. She may have been partially based on Sue Edwards, the brief accomplice of Richard Allen Davis (who was mentioned in the episode) - Both were accomplices to a pedophilic abductor and have nearly identical names. The girls being taken from a well lit, alley-less, and crowded area also implicates they were acquainted with their abductor and went with him willingly. The necklace Katie wore being ripped from her neck and tossed in the trash indicated an unsub driven by rage and a personal vendetta, not one driven by lust, who would not bother to waste time committing such a seemingly pointless act.
